暗号資産(仮想通貨)の新技術「ライトニングネットワーク」解説



暗号資産(仮想通貨)の新技術「ライトニングネットワーク」解説


暗号資産(仮想通貨)の新技術「ライトニングネットワーク」解説

はじめに

暗号資産(仮想通貨)は、その分散性と透明性から、金融システムに革新をもたらす可能性を秘めています。しかし、初期の暗号資産、特にビットコインは、取引処理能力の低さという課題を抱えていました。この課題を克服するために開発されたのが、「ライトニングネットワーク」です。本稿では、ライトニングネットワークの技術的な詳細、利点、課題、そして将来展望について、専門的な視点から解説します。

ビットコインの抱える課題

ビットコインは、ブロックチェーンという分散型台帳を用いて取引を記録・検証します。このブロックチェーンは、約10分間隔で新しいブロックが追加されるため、取引の承認に時間がかかります。また、ブロックの容量には制限があり、一度に処理できる取引数も限られています。これらの制限により、ビットコインは大量の小額決済を処理するには不向きであり、スケーラビリティ問題が深刻化していました。

さらに、取引手数料も問題でした。取引量が増加すると、手数料が高騰し、少額決済では手数料が取引額を上回ってしまうこともありました。これらの課題は、ビットコインの日常的な利用を妨げる要因となっていました。

ライトニングネットワークの概要

ライトニングネットワークは、ビットコインのスケーラビリティ問題を解決するために提案された、オフチェーンのスケーリングソリューションです。オフチェーンとは、ブロックチェーンの外で取引を行うことを意味します。ライトニングネットワークでは、参加者間で直接的な支払いチャネルを確立し、そのチャネル内で多数の取引を迅速かつ低コストで行います。これらの取引は、最終的にブロックチェーンに記録されますが、個々の取引はブロックチェーン上で直接処理されるわけではありません。

ライトニングネットワークの基本的な仕組みは、以下の通りです。

1. **支払いチャネルの確立:** 2人の参加者が、一定量のビットコインをロックアップし、支払いチャネルを確立します。
2. **オフチェーン取引:** 確立されたチャネル内で、参加者間は自由にビットコインを送受信できます。これらの取引は、ブロックチェーンに記録されません。
3. **チャネルのクローズ:** 参加者間で合意された時点で、チャネルをクローズし、最終的な残高をブロックチェーンに記録します。

この仕組みにより、多数の取引をブロックチェーンの外で処理できるため、取引速度が向上し、手数料が削減されます。

ライトニングネットワークの技術的な詳細

ライトニングネットワークは、ハッシュタイムロックコントラクト(HTLC)と呼ばれるスマートコントラクトを利用しています。HTLCは、特定の条件が満たされた場合にのみ、資金が解放されるように設計されています。ライトニングネットワークでは、HTLCを組み合わせることで、安全なオフチェーン取引を実現しています。

具体的には、以下の手順で取引が行われます。

1. **支払い要求:** 送金者は、受取人に対して支払い要求を作成します。この要求には、受取人の公開鍵、支払い金額、そしてハッシュ値が含まれます。
2. **経路探索:** 送金者は、受取人までの支払い経路を探索します。ライトニングネットワークは、ノード間の接続で構成されており、送金者は、経路上のノードを介して受取人に資金を送金します。
3. **HTLCの作成:** 経路上の各ノードは、HTLCを作成します。HTLCには、受取人が秘密鍵を提示することで資金が解放されるという条件が含まれています。
4. **秘密鍵の提示:** 受取人は、支払い要求に含まれるハッシュ値に対応する秘密鍵を提示します。これにより、経路上の各ノードがHTLCを解除し、資金が受取人に送金されます。

HTLCを使用することで、中間ノードが資金を不正に奪うことを防ぎ、安全なオフチェーン取引を実現しています。

ライトニングネットワークの利点

ライトニングネットワークは、ビットコインのスケーラビリティ問題を解決するだけでなく、様々な利点をもたらします。

* **高速な取引:** オフチェーンで取引を行うため、取引速度が大幅に向上します。数秒以内に取引が完了することが可能です。
* **低コストな手数料:** ブロックチェーン上で取引を行うよりも、手数料が大幅に削減されます。特に小額決済に適しています。
* **プライバシーの向上:** オフチェーンで取引を行うため、取引履歴がブロックチェーン上に公開されにくく、プライバシーが向上します。
* **マイクロペイメントの実現:** 低コストで高速な取引が可能になるため、マイクロペイメント(少額決済)が実現可能になります。コンテンツの購入やストリーミングサービスなど、様々な用途が考えられます。
* **グローバルな決済:** 国境を越えた決済が容易になります。従来の国際送金に比べて、時間とコストを大幅に削減できます。

ライトニングネットワークの課題

ライトニングネットワークは、多くの利点を持つ一方で、いくつかの課題も抱えています。

* **流動性の問題:** 支払いチャネルには、一定量のビットコインをロックアップする必要があります。流動性が低い場合、十分な資金をチャネルに確保できないため、取引が制限される可能性があります。
* **経路探索の複雑さ:** 受取人までの最適な支払い経路を探索することは、複雑な問題です。経路上のノードがオフラインであったり、十分な流動性を持っていなかったりすると、取引が失敗する可能性があります。
* **チャネル管理の煩雑さ:** 支払いチャネルの開設、維持、クローズには、ある程度の技術的な知識が必要です。一般ユーザーにとっては、チャネル管理が煩雑であると感じられる可能性があります。
* **セキュリティリスク:** HTLCは安全な仕組みですが、実装上の脆弱性や、経路上のノードの不正行為によって、資金が失われるリスクも存在します。
* **ネットワーク効果の重要性:** ライトニングネットワークの利点を最大限に活かすためには、多くの参加者と、十分な流動性を持つネットワークが必要です。ネットワーク効果が低い場合、取引が制限される可能性があります。

ライトニングネットワークの現状と将来展望

ライトニングネットワークは、2017年に初めて提案されて以来、着実に開発が進められています。現在、様々なウォレットや決済サービスがライトニングネットワークに対応しており、利用可能なノード数も増加しています。しかし、依然として課題も多く、本格的な普及には時間がかかると予想されます。

今後の展望としては、以下の点が挙げられます。

* **流動性の向上:** 流動性プロバイダーの登場や、自動マーケットメーカー(AMM)の導入により、流動性が向上すると期待されます。
* **経路探索の最適化:** より効率的な経路探索アルゴリズムの開発により、取引の成功率が向上すると期待されます。
* **チャネル管理の簡素化:** ユーザーフレンドリーなウォレットやツールの開発により、チャネル管理が簡素化されると期待されます。
* **セキュリティの強化:** HTLCの実装上の脆弱性の修正や、経路上のノードの監視体制の強化により、セキュリティが向上すると期待されます。
* **相互運用性の向上:** 他の暗号資産やブロックチェーンとの相互運用性を高めることで、ライトニングネットワークの利用範囲が拡大すると期待されます。

ライトニングネットワークは、ビットコインのスケーラビリティ問題を解決し、暗号資産の普及を促進する可能性を秘めた重要な技術です。今後の開発と普及に期待が高まります。

まとめ

ライトニングネットワークは、ビットコインのスケーラビリティ問題を解決するための革新的なオフチェーンスケーリングソリューションです。高速な取引、低コストな手数料、プライバシーの向上など、多くの利点をもたらしますが、流動性の問題、経路探索の複雑さ、チャネル管理の煩雑さなどの課題も抱えています。今後の開発と普及により、これらの課題が克服され、ライトニングネットワークが暗号資産の普及に大きく貢献することが期待されます。本稿が、ライトニングネットワークの理解を深める一助となれば幸いです。


前の記事

暗号資産(仮想通貨)市場に影響を与えるニュースを見極める方法

次の記事

ヘデラ(HBAR)初心者が始める仮想通貨投資手順